Chapter 100: Chapter 80: Three Calamities and Nine Tribulations, Identity Exposed

Songhai City.

By the Huangpu River, the once murky yellow water had now turned completely black. Beneath it, countless dense shadows writhed and shifted.

Atop a skyscraper dozens of stories high, Immortal Emperor Zhao Li stood before a set of floor-to-ceiling windows, surveying Songhai City, nearly half of which was now flooded.

SWISH! SWISH! SWISH!

A small Bronze Sword danced in the air beside him.

Tonight, he had inherited another 5% of his Cultivation. At this moment, Zhao Li’s Cultivation Realm had reached the Nascent Soul Stage. Seeing that he would inherit 50% of his Cultivation tomorrow, Zhao Li guessed that after the following night, his Cultivation would reach the Integration Stage at the very least.

SWISH!

After acclimating to the new power in his body, Zhao Li used his Divine Sense to control the antique Bronze Sword he’d found at home, sending it plunging directly into the black river water at the edge of his vision.

ROAR!

The river water churned, and a pool of blood quickly spread to the surface. Then, at the location where the blood had surfaced, shadows stirred, and countless enormous black dorsal fins broke through the churning water. 𝕗𝐫𝐞𝕖𝕨𝐞𝗯𝚗𝕠𝘃𝐞𝚕.𝐜𝗼𝚖

SWISH!

Zhao Li recalled the Flying Sword, and it returned to his side.

Because he had only inherited his Cultivation—and not his Magic, Magical Treasures, or other abilities—Zhao Li currently possessed only raw Magical Power. His offensive options were limited. The attack method he had settled on was using his Divine Sense to control the Flying Sword.

As a Nascent Soul Stage cultivator, his Divine Sense could currently cover a 50-kilometer radius with ease. This distance was far less than what he had in the game. Zhao Li guessed that his Combat Power must have been recalibrated.

Still, having inherited only 10% of his total Cultivation, Zhao Li was full of confidence for the future.

His parents had been killed last night. Thanks to the comfort of his many girlfriends, Zhao Li had finally recovered emotionally. However, a deep-seated hatred festered within him. From now on, he vowed to kill every Gluttonous Snake he saw, to flay every one he found.

Three Calamities and Nine Tribulations?

After briefly testing his abilities, Zhao Li turned his attention to the personal status panel that had been updated in version 4.2.

[Name: Zhao Li]

[Health: 10,000 (Three Calamities and Nine Tribulations)]

[Realm: Nascent Soul Stage]

.

.

[Individual Combat Power: 100,000]

[Note: Data conversion is still being improved and optimized...]

After he inherited the second wave of game abilities tonight, version 4.2—whose meaning no one understood—began its update. Looking at the newly updated personal panel, Zhao Li’s brow furrowed. He hadn’t expected that after the update, a [Three Calamities and Nine Tribulations] status would appear next to his health. Although he didn’t know what this meant, that phrase certainly didn’t sound like anything good.

He had already seen online that most people’s health didn’t exceed 15, whereas his own digitized health was 10,000. Zhao Li had been quite happy about this, but the "Three Calamities and Nine Tribulations" after his health greatly dampened his joy.

As he frowned over his condition, Zhao Li muttered about the situation in Songhai City. "A beast tide is about to hit Songhai City too! And it’s coming from the water! Those things are huge!"

Beast tides had already erupted in many places during the day, but those were all on land. Ever since last night, the waters near the coastal Songhai City had been filled with dense, dark shadows. Using his Divine Sense and the Bronze Sword from a moment ago, Zhao Li determined that it was highly probable an oceanic beast tide would erupt in the half-flooded city.

Although his parents were already dead, leaving him with no one to hold him back, Zhao Li could easily leave Songhai City with his Nascent Soul Stage Cultivation. But this city was, after all, the place where he had lived and grown up. Moreover, the families of several of his girlfriends were also here.

The intricate network of rivers around Songhai City had widened significantly as the Earth expanded. It was now incredibly difficult for ordinary people to leave, blocked as they were by the widened rivers teeming with dark shadows. Zhao Li was contemplating what he should do if a beast tide were to erupt.

"Brother Li!!!" one of his girlfriends suddenly cried out, bringing a phone over to him. "Quick, look at this!!! A beast tide erupted in Qing City—an Undead Calamity!"

Not long after receiving his second inheritance of game abilities, Zhao Li saw it—the tide-like Undead Calamity that had erupted in Xia Country’s Qing City.

"Hm?"

"Hm?"

"Hm??"

Just as he was about to feel a pang of regret for Qing City, which was on the verge of being overwhelmed by the monster tide, both Zhao Li and his girlfriend beside him suddenly froze. They saw that in the area where the Undead Calamity had broken out, countless Water Tornadoes and Fire Tornadoes had appeared. After that, under a single pillar of Destructive Light, the entire Undead Calamity was wiped out.

Holy crap!

He never imagined the monster tide could be annihilated in a single move. Because of the dark shadows in the waters around Songhai City, Zhao Li had simulated scenarios of fending off a monster tide. In his simulations, if he were to fight the tide, his only current option was to use his Divine Sense to control the Bronze Sword, piercing back and forth across the battlefield. But with his current Magical Power, he could only control the Flying Sword to continuously sweep the area for three hours at most. After that, his Magical Power would be completely depleted.

Although the Spiritual Qi on Earth was gradually becoming denser as the planet expanded and upgraded, it would still take several hours to recover the Magical Power of a Nascent Soul Stage cultivator. He had simulated it—even at the Nascent Soul Stage, he couldn’t easily fend off a monster tide. But now, seeing the one in Qing City, Zhao Li was stunned.

*Tower Defense of Ten Thousand Realms*? Skyrocketing?

When he saw people on the livestream speculating that this might be an ability from the game *Tower Defense of Ten Thousand Realms*, Zhao Li was stunned once again. He had played *Tower Defense of Ten Thousand Realms* too! He had even spent a ton of money on it, though he just couldn’t compare to that whale, "Skyrocketing."

If this really is an ability inherited from *Tower Defense of Ten Thousand Realms*... then...

Comparing those invincible Fire Tornadoes and the Destructive Light to the small Bronze Sword floating beside him, Zhao Li suddenly felt a pang in his chest for some reason. It hurt a lot.

"Brother Li!! Look!!!" Before the heartache could even subside, the girlfriend next to him cried out in alarm again.

What the hell!

Looking at the phone his girlfriend immediately handed him, Zhao Li’s anger flared. A Gluttonous Snake! A massive, fully-grown one, and according to the bullet comments, it was a Gluttonous Snake that had already devoured an entire city. It was being broadcast live.

HUFF. HUFF. HUFF.

Facing the massive Gluttonous Snake, Zhao Li grew agitated. He thought of his parents, who had been devoured by one.

"Ah!!!!"

But before Zhao Li could calm himself, his girlfriend suddenly shrieked again. Then, Zhao Li saw a gigantic Heavy Sword, hundreds of meters long, descend from the sky and viciously smash down on the Gluttonous Snake’s head. The swaggering, seemingly invincible monster was instantly reduced to smithereens.

I...

He turned his head, glancing from the enormous Heavy Sword in the video to the arm’s-length sword beside him. The intense pain in Zhao Li’s chest returned.

Once his breathing steadied, thanks to several of his girlfriends placing their delicate hands on his chest to calm him, Zhao Li immediately shouted, "Qing City!! That’s Qing City!!! That’s definitely Skyrocketing!!! It has to be him!!"

Although there were all sorts of guesses in the livestream chat about the big shot in Qing City, with some even speculating it might be the "Immortal Emperor," and the members of the "Immortal Court" QQ group he’d founded were exploding with speculation and asking if it was him, Zhao Li, as the Immortal Emperor himself, knew it wasn’t. But based on his sixth sense, he was certain it was Skyrocketing.

"Let’s go!" he declared. "We’re joining the Tourism Management Office! The Immortal Court is suspending recruitment! At least until I inherit the second and third sets of Magical Treasures and Magic, we’re not talking about the Immortal Court!"

Spurred by Skyrocketing’s actions in Qing City, Zhao Li resolved to join Songhai City’s Tourism Management Office. Of course, this was only a temporary measure. He had previously received an invitation from them but hadn’t joined. However, many of his rich, second-generation friends had. Now, having witnessed the world-destroying power of the expert in Qing City, Zhao Li wanted to join the Tourism Management Office to get some intel.

Besides this person’s immense power, there was another, more important reason why Zhao Li wanted to gather information on them: they had easily annihilated the Gluttonous Snake. And Zhao Li had long since come to see the Gluttonous Snake as his lifelong enemy. Anyone capable of killing a Gluttonous Snake was someone Zhao Li was willing to befriend.

***

What? Sun Yu? Brother Kaipan?

Because he had Immortal Emperor-level game abilities to inherit, and because many of his rich, second-generation friends were in the Songhai City Tourism Management Office, Zhao Li managed to obtain the organization’s information regarding the speculated identity of "Skyrocketing" after making a few promises. He even saw a note saying that Tower Masters have very low health.

***

"Director, why are we releasing the information on Brother Kaipan?"

In the main conference room of the Divine Capital Tourism Management Office, only two people remained. One of them asked the Director.

"Because even if we didn’t, we couldn’t keep it a secret!" the Director slowly replied. "The chaotic era is here! With all networks losing their monitoring, the moment this information was calculated, it became impossible to keep secret! It’s also good to let others probe the depths of this Brother Kaipan for us! Besides, if by some chance Brother Kaipan can’t handle it, it gives us the perfect opportunity to play the ’hero saving the damsel’ and win him over to our side..."

"The chaotic era is here!" the Director said, his voice growing quieter as he fiddled with a small, mahjong-tile-like cube in his hand. "The team is getting hard to lead!"

"Director," the head of the information department said quickly, seeing his superior’s lack of enthusiasm, "several unregistered alliances privately established by players have come to register with us! Just now, the Magic Game Alliance, the Gunpowder Game Alliance, and the Martial Hero Game Alliance all submitted their registration information. Several of the more arrogant player-founded alliances have also lowered their profiles, and some have gone completely silent!"

"Why?" the Director asked faintly, looking at the fragment of the Xia Country’s National Treasure Divine Artifact in his hand, of which he had inherited 10%.

"Because of the three attacks in Qing City just now! Because of the information we released, everyone online now accepts that those three powerful attacks came from Defense Towers, and specifically from the game *Tower Defense of Ten Thousand Realms*. And our Divine Capital Tourism Management Office has Taiyi Zhenren, the number two player on the *Tower Defense of Ten Thousand Realms* Combat Power rankings! That’s why these organizations, which were getting quite audacious, have all quieted down. The number two player on the rankings instantly intimidated all those petty upstarts! Director, your decision to promote Huang Yi to First Deputy Director showed incredible foresight!" the department head reported quickly, not forgetting to kiss up a little.

"Very good," the Director said with a wave of his hand. "Then continue."

He hadn’t expected that the three attacks in Qing City would make the player organizations so obedient. Clearly, these people wouldn’t dare cause any more trouble until they figured out Huang Yi’s true strength. This had inadvertently cleared many obstacles for the Tourism Management Office.
